At a Glance
- Tasks: Build and maintain a scalable trading platform while collaborating with global teams.
- Company: Join a leading investment manager focused on operational excellence.
- Benefits: Competitive salary, dynamic work environment, and opportunities for professional growth.
- Why this job: Make a real impact in finance technology and enhance trading strategies.
- Qualifications: 3+ years in Python development and experience with Linux/Unix environments.
- Other info: Fast-paced role with opportunities to innovate and drive value creation.
Systematic Operations Engineer – Support Technology
We are looking for an experienced professional to help us scale our systematic operations and support capabilities. This role directly supports portfolio management teams across Millennium, with operational excellence at the core. Our efforts are focused on delivering the highest quality returns to our investors – providing a world-class and reliable trading and technology platform is essential to this mission. This is a unique opportunity to drive significant value creation for one of the world’s leading investment managers.
Principal Responsibilities
- Build, develop and maintain a reliable, scalable, and integrated platform for trading strategy monitoring, reporting, and operations.
- Interface with business stakeholders, gather technical requirements for onboarding external portfolio managers, and create a global process to support workflow.
- Conduct meetings with key members of the global support team to ensure consistent onboarding process is maintained globally.
- Work with internal portfolio managers and internal development team(s) to reduce operational risk through automation, deep understanding of technology stack, and validation practices.
- Identify gaps in monitoring/reporting of critical components and create solutions to address these gaps.
- Streamline deployment processes of applications.
Technical Qualifications
- 3+ years of development experience in Python.
- Experience working in a Linux/Unix environment.
- Experience working with PostgreSQL or other relational databases.
- Ability to understand and discuss requirements from portfolio managers, both internal and external to Millennium, as well as trading services.
Preferred Skills and Experience
- Experience operating and monitoring low-latency trading environments.
- Familiarity with quantitative finance and electronic trading concepts.
- Familiarity with financial data.
- Broad understanding of equities, futures, FX, or other financial instruments.
- Experience designing and developing distributed systems with a focus on backend development in C/C++, Java, Scala, Go, or C#.
- Experience automating SDLC pipelines (e.g., Jenkins, TeamCity, or AWS CodePipeline).
- Experience with containerization, orchestration, and messaging technologies – Kafka, Solace, Airflow, HTCondor, Dagster, and Docker/Kubernetes.
- Experience building and deploying systems that utilize services provided by AWS, GCP or Azure.
- Contributions to open-source projects.
Other Qualifications
- BA/BS degree in a quantitative field. Graduate degree preferred, but not required.
- Results‑oriented, able to deliver quality production code with quick turnaround.
- Excellent listening and communication (both oral and written) skills.
- Self‑starter and critical thinker who takes ownership of projects and suggests improvements for the entire infrastructure.
- Proactive, assertive, and attentive to detail.
- Can work independently and in a collaborative environment.
- Can handle several projects with different priorities at the same time in a fast‑paced environment.
- Quick learner with a tenacious approach to solving problems.
#J-18808-Ljbffr
Systematic Operations Engineer - Support Technology employer: Millennium Management LLC
Contact Detail:
Millennium Management LLC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Systematic Operations Engineer - Support Technology
✨Tip Number 1
Network like a pro! Reach out to folks in the industry, attend meetups, and connect on LinkedIn. You never know who might have the inside scoop on job openings or can put in a good word for you.
✨Tip Number 2
Prepare for those interviews! Research the company and its tech stack, especially around Python and trading environments. Practice common interview questions and be ready to showcase your problem-solving skills.
✨Tip Number 3
Show off your projects! If you've contributed to open-source or built something cool, make sure to highlight it. Having tangible examples of your work can really set you apart from the competition.
✨Tip Number 4
Apply through our website! It’s the best way to ensure your application gets seen. Plus, we love seeing candidates who are proactive about their job search!
We think you need these skills to ace Systematic Operations Engineer - Support Technology
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the role of Systematic Operations Engineer. Highlight your experience with Python, Linux/Unix, and any relevant projects that showcase your skills in trading environments. We want to see how your background aligns with our mission!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how you can contribute to our operational excellence. Be sure to mention any specific experiences that relate to portfolio management or automation.
Showcase Your Technical Skills: Don’t hold back on showcasing your technical skills! Mention your experience with PostgreSQL, containerization, and any other technologies listed in the job description. We love seeing candidates who are well-versed in the tools we use every day.
Apply Through Our Website: We encourage you to apply through our website for a smoother application process. It helps us keep track of your application and ensures you don’t miss out on any important updates. Plus, it’s super easy!
How to prepare for a job interview at Millennium Management LLC
✨Know Your Tech Stack
Make sure you brush up on your Python, Linux/Unix, and PostgreSQL skills. Be ready to discuss how you've used these technologies in past projects, especially in relation to trading environments. This will show that you understand the technical requirements of the role.
✨Understand the Business Context
Familiarise yourself with the financial instruments mentioned in the job description, like equities and futures. Being able to speak knowledgeably about how your technical skills can support portfolio management teams will set you apart from other candidates.
✨Prepare for Scenario Questions
Expect questions that ask you to solve hypothetical problems related to operational risk or automation. Think through examples from your experience where you've identified gaps and implemented solutions, as this aligns perfectly with the responsibilities of the role.
✨Show Your Collaborative Spirit
This role requires working closely with various teams, so be prepared to discuss how you've successfully collaborated in the past. Highlight any experiences where you’ve interfaced with stakeholders or led meetings to ensure a smooth onboarding process.